Abstract

PURPOSE: To enhance the pressure resistance and elastic force in the thickness direction and enable the good holding of a three-dimensional structure by forming a three-dimensional structural net having string line parts dividing mesh openings constituted into an air-and water-permeable three-dimensional structural net shape. CONSTITUTION: This truss type three-dimensional structural net is obtained by respectively braiding or weaving synthetic fiber yarns into a front and a back ground fabric parts 3 and 4 and constituting string line parts 1 dividing mesh openings 2 with connecting yarns 5 connecting the front and back ground fabrics so as to form a three-dimensional shape having air-and water-permeable voids. The string line parts 1 are constituted so as to knot with the adjacent string line parts located at shifted positions in the front and back ground fabrics 3 and 4 and alternately tilt the connecting yarns connecting the front and back ground fabrics in the respective string line parts left and right for each mesh opening and form a truss structure.

2. Description of the Related Art For example,
As a net to be used as an embedding material for protecting the slopes of constructed land and levees and having a water collection and drainage effect, a conventional net with a three-dimensional structure in which the cord portion is simply a string is heavy and difficult to handle. Since there is a problem in construction workability and inferior elasticity and water collecting and draining effect, the applicant of the present invention has made the cord portion that defines the mesh holes hollow by allowing the connecting yarn and the front and back substrates to breathe and permeate. A three-dimensional net having a three-dimensional structure has been proposed (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 5-187011).

However, in the proposed three-dimensional structured net, the nodal portions of the cord portions that define the mesh holes are at the same position on the front and back sides, and the openings of the mesh holes on the front and back sides have the same shape. The connecting yarns between the front and back substrates forming the side faces are substantially orthogonal to the front and back faces.

Therefore, since the cord portion has a substantially hollow three-dimensional shape, the space between the front and back substrates of the three-dimensional structured net, that is, the thicker the net, the more problematic the pressure resistance is. Therefore, when a large load or pressure is applied in the thickness direction, there is a possibility that the cord portion may collapse or collapse to one side. If the cord portion is crushed, the thickness of the three-dimensionally structured net and the void retention rate decrease, and the effect of the three-dimensional structure cannot be expected. For example, it is buried in the soil as a net for collecting and draining slopes and a protective net,
Or, when it is stretched on the slope and used, the desired ventilation and drainage effect cannot be obtained.

Further, since the mesh holes of the above-mentioned three-dimensional structured net are opened in the same position and shape on the front and back sides, the covering area when stretched and used on the slope etc. is not so large, and seeds, soil, etc. The retention of is not so high.

The present invention has been made in view of the above, and the three-dimensional structure is stable by forming the truss structure in which the positions of the knot portions in the front and back base parts of the cord portion are different on the front and back sides. The pressure resistance and elasticity in the thickness direction are excellent, and the characteristics due to the three-dimensional structure can be maintained well,
The present invention provides a three-dimensional structural net that can be widely and suitably used for various purposes.

According to the above-mentioned three-dimensional structured net of the present invention,
Since the string part that defines the mesh holes has a three-dimensional structure with a void that allows ventilation and water permeability, the net as a whole has a three-dimensional structure that has the required thickness, and because of the void part of the string part, it is good It possesses excellent ventilation and water permeability.

In particular, in the cord portion, since the knots in the front and back base parts are at mutually different positions and the connecting parts between the front and back base parts are alternately inclined left and right to form a truss structure, On the other hand, when a load or pressure is applied in the thickness direction, they act to mutually regulate the collapse of the cord portions, and the shape of the mesh holes and the three-dimensional structure of the net become stable. That is, it is strong against load and pressure in the thickness direction, has excellent pressure resistance and shape retention, and can have good elastic force.

In the above three-dimensional structured net (A),
The yarns constituting the front and back substrate parts (3) and (4) are not particularly limited, but synthetic fiber yarns having excellent water resistance are usually used, and nylon yarns, carbon fiber yarns and various other synthetic yarns are used. A fiber multifilament yarn or a monofilament yarn is preferably used. The thickness and material are determined in consideration of strength, tension, elasticity, etc. required for the application.
Further, as the connecting yarn (5), the front and back base parts (3) are used.
In order to be suitable for connecting (4) and supporting it in a three-dimensional manner, it is appropriately selected from the synthetic fiber yarns in consideration of elasticity, strength and the like as described above, and mainly monofilament yarns are preferably used. These yarns can be given appropriate rigidity and compression resistance by heat setting after knitting or by processing synthetic resin. Further, as the number of connecting yarns (5) connecting the front and back substrate portions (3) and (4) increases and the density increases, the pressure resistance and elastic force in the thickness direction increase. Of course, the thicker the thread is from the same material such as nylon, the stronger the waist becomes.

In this case, the stitches formed by warp knitting and the like are fixedly held to reinforce the base portion, there is no fear of loosening or fraying of the mesh, and the structure becomes stable, and the net having higher strength and elasticity is obtained. Is obtained. When the resin coating is carried out by a dipping means, the connecting yarn (5) between the front and back base materials (3) and (4) has a relatively coarse density and does not retain the resin, so the entire net is dipped. However, the ventilation and water permeability of the connecting portion are not impaired. In addition, by appropriately setting the amount of resin adhered to the front and back base parts, it is possible to ensure ventilation and water permeability of the base parts.
